Can You Fly From Lima To Uyumi?

The best way to get from Lima to Uyuni is to fly which takes 8h 53m and costs $170 – $700.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$70 – $110 and takes 38h 30m.

Can you fly from Lima to Machu Picchu?

From Lima, it is necessary to stop in Cusco before heading to Machu Picchu as there are no direct flights, trains or buses to Machu Picchu.

Can you fly from Lima to Cusco?

Flying from Lima to Cusco

One is by flying, which is the easiest option, but not as scenic and adventurous as other alternatives. This first option will allow you to arrive in Cusco in just 1 hour and 10 minutes. You can choose between LATAM, Viva Air, Avianca, SKY Airline, and Avianca.

Is Peru expensive?

Peru is one of the least expensive countries to live in South America. You can cover your basic expenses for $2,000 per month or less in most areas other than in Lima. Living in the capital costs you a bit more for the same quality of life as you would experience in outlying areas.

Is Lima Peru safe for tourists?

Short answer: yes. Visiting Lima is just like visiting any other metropolitan area. There is, of course, a risk of petty crime. But Lima is largely safe if you stick to the main touristic areas, such as Miraflores and Barranco.

Is it better to fly into Cusco or Lima?

Is It Better To Fly Into Cusco or Lima? The majority of the time it will be cheaper to fly into Lima as opposed to Cusco. Although both airports offer international flights, Lima regularly offers cheaper flights no matter where you are flying from.

Which airport do you fly into for Machu Picchu?

Jorge Chávez International Airport is Peru’s main airport, a one and a half hour flight from Cusco, Machu Picchu’s closest airport.
